Abstract
The invention discloses a kind of communication water bands, and connection is incorporated into the hose carcase with body, and inductance type driver and communication connection plug are fixedly mounted in No.1 quick coupling, wireless signal receiver is fixedly mounted in No. two quick couplings;It is an advantage of the invention that:It is incorporated into connection in band body, ensure that the communication signal in fire-fighting and rescue, is reduced due to communicating the unsmooth security risk brought;Aqueduct of the water band as underground coal mine is communicated, can be used for underground coal mine routine use, it is not necessary to still further set up connection, improve utilization rate of equipment and installations;It is light removable to communicate water band, it is more flexible compared to traditional fixed communication apparatus;By elastic rubber ring being arranged so that hook has certain stroke, so as to make up foozle, generation the case where to avoid hook can not be caught in card slot caused by foozle.
Description
Technical field
The invention belongs to fire hose technical fields, and in particular to a kind of communication water band.
Background technology
Fire hose is a kind of tubulose narrow fabrics that can bear certain liq pressure, can convey at elevated pressures water, oil,
Foam fire-fighting liquid etc. is widely used in oil transportation, conveying fresh water, agricultural irrigation, industrial and mineral and construction site and send water, draining etc..
Currently, in fire-fighting and rescue, the case where often will appear communicating interrupt, lead to confusing communication between commander and fireman;
Once accident occurs, original communication apparatus cannot use underground coal mine, and underground does not have a signal, command centre and rescue personnel,
It waits for that the communicating interrupt between rescue personnel, searching wait for that rescue personnel just spends many times, misses best rescue time, enhancing is logical
News signal just seems most important.
Common tool in fire hose inherently fire-fighting and rescue, and underground coal mine is also usually provided with aqueduct,
If fire hose can be made full use of as signal transmission tool, can play a multiplier effect.

Specific implementation mode
In order to be more clearly understood that technical scheme of the present invention, the following further describes the present invention with reference to the drawings.
Communication water band as shown in Figure 1, which is characterized in that including:Band body 1, connection 2, quick coupling, inductance type driving
Device 6, communication connection plug 7, wireless signal receiver 9 and heat-shrink tube,
The band body 1 includes hose carcase and lining coating, there is lining coating, the water band braiding in the hose carcase
Layer is woven by asbestos cord, nylon rope, connection 2,2 length of the connection be from band body one end to the other end, it is described logical
It includes plastic protective layer, luminescent coating, external electrode and central electrode to interrogate line 2, and 2 end of the connection passes through the pyrocondensation seal of tube;
The quick coupling includes No.1 quick coupling 3 and No. two quick couplings 4, and the No.1 quick coupling 3 is set to the band
1 left end of body, No. two quick coupling 4 are set to 1 right end of band body, and the No.1 quick coupling 3 includes 31 He of No.1 ontology
Hook 32, the No.1 ontology 31 and the hook 32 are an integral molding structure, and the root of the hook 32 stretches to described one
In number ontology 31, and elastic rubber ring is provided between the ontology 31 and the root, No. two quick coupling 4 includes two
Number ontology 41 and card slot 42, No. two ontologies 41 and the card slot 42 are an integral molding structure, the hook 32 and the card
Slot 42 is clamped, and the No.1 ontology 31 is equipped with circular hole 5, the No.1 sheet with No. two ontologies 41 close to 1 side of band body
Inductance type driver 6 and communication connection plug 7 is fixedly mounted in 31 outside of body, and wireless communication is fixedly mounted in 41 outside of No. two ontologies
Number receiver 9;
1 both ends of band body connect the quick coupling, the external electrode of 2 left end of the connection and center by clip 8 respectively
Electrode is connect across the circular hole 5 with the inductance type driver 6, the inductance type driver 6 and the communication connection plug 7
Connection, the inductance type driver 6 is interior to be equipped with charge power supply, and the external electrode and central electrode of 2 right end of the connection pass through institute
Circular hole 5 is stated to connect with the wireless signal receiver 9.
In this preferred embodiment, a diameter of 0.8mm of the connection 2;Hot melt can be added before the pyrocondensation seal of tube
Glue keeps its waterproof and folding resistance more preferable;The inductance driver 6 is equipped with switch.
Operation principle:It is connected by quick coupling between band body 1, passes through pyrocondensation between the connection 2 of every section of communication water band
Pipe 9 connects the external electrode of connection 2 into a line, at fire water supply and central electrode passes through the circular hole 5 and the electricity
Sense formula driver 6 connects, and the inductance type driver 6 connect with the communication connection plug 7, communicate to connect plug 7 with it is external
Power supply connects, and wireless signal receiver 9 receives signal, and signal is transmitted by connection 2 along communication water band, can be in fire-fighting and rescue
Meanwhile playing the role of signal transmission.
